Output e29fae88166cac93c55158d94dd641035193a06e790b5b1415bddde0bbc8d983:1

value
25952049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50d2a40b8d5c71aa2561e05e7caa916b2ef4d65 OP_EQUAL
address
3Kevp4KaHbx2N7tP7nE8KVPRSJSgUNKC8m
transaction
e29fae88166cac93c55158d94dd641035193a06e790b5b1415bddde0bbc8d983
spent
true